Tomoki Harakawa is a ghost that appears in Fatal Frame V. He was the former owner of Ichiru Manor, the inn at Mikomori Hot Springs. In the landslide that engulfed the mountain, half of the inn was buried, and Tomoki's wife and daughter were both killed. Having lost everything, Tomoki decided to commit suicide. He set fire to what remained of the inn, made his way up to the roof where he could see the sunset, and was hesitating over whether or not to jump when a ghost tugged on his leg. As he fell, he crashed through a window and pierced his back with large pieces of glass.
Tomoki's father also lived on the mountain. He built the inn upon the structure of the abandoned maiden shrine, and when Keiji Watarai arrived with hopes of studying the mountain's history, the two became friends. They worked together to collect postmortem photographs from the area and assemble them into an album. After Keiji went missing, Tomoki's father helped in the search, but all he found was the photo album. Harakawa Sr. was ultimately spirited away as well. He left the book of post-mortem photographs to his son, and Tomoki rediscovered them shortly after the landslide that killed his family. Tomoki's notes about them put Ren Hojo on the trail of Keiji Watarai.
